Panasonic launches Lumix G100 vlogging camera for $749

Panasonic has launched the new Lumix G100, a compact, interchangeable lens camera designed for vlogging. The G100 features a "smartphone crushing" 20.3MP Micro Four Thirds sensor without Low Pass Filter and with 5-axis hybrid image stabilizer. The camera can record 4K video in 24p or 30p or 1080p video in 60p. The video can be recorded in a multitude of aspect ratios, including Instagram friendly 4:5, 5:4 and 9:16. New iOS 14 feature shows just how many apps are snooping on your clipboard

A new feature in iOS 14 developer beta 1 has some users taken by surprise. The feature alerts the user every time an app access the clipboard for whatever reason, and let's just say there are way too many apps today that are accessing your clipboard for seemingly no reason at all. If you are running iOS 14 developer beta 1 and copy an item to your clipboard then the OS will show a pop-up notification at the top of the screen informing you whenever an app has accessed the data in your clipboard. iOS 14 beta users report seeing 4K option in the YouTube app

Multiple iPhone users running the first developer beta of iOS 14 are reporting that they are now seeing their YouTube video resolution going all the way up to 2160p or 4K. YouTube resolution has been limited to all iOS and iPadOS devices due to a codec compatibility issue. YouTube encodes its videos in two codecs, AVC1 (h.264) or Google's own VP9. However, while VP9 encoded videos are available in all resolutions and frame rate options, AVC1 encoded videos are only available up to 1080p60 resolution. Samsung Pay Card is in the works in partnership with Curve

Samsung and Curve announced a partnership that will bring the Samsung Pay Card later this year. If you haven't heard of Curve, it's a fintech company that created the Curve Card, which pretends to be a normal Mastercard debit card but is more of an all-in-one solution. You don't keep money in a Curve account, instead you add cards from other banks and decide which card you'd like to spend from each time using an app on your phone.
